#5bdc82 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5bdc82 is composed of 35.7% red, 86.3%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.9%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 138.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 61%. #5bdc82 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ffff with #00b905.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#5bdc82 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5bdc82 has RGB values of R:91, G:220,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 6020226.

Hex triplet 5bdc82 #5bdc82
RGB Decimal 91, 220, 130 rgb(91,220,130)
RGB Percent 35.7, 86.3, 51 rgb(35.7%,86.3%,51%)
CMYK 59, 0, 41, 14
HSL 138.1°, 64.8, 61 hsl(138.1,64.8%,61%)
HSV (or HSB) 138.1°, 58.6, 86.3
Web Safe 66cc99 #66cc99
CIE-LAB 79.053, -55, 33.815
XYZ 33.935, 55.02, 29.949
xyY 0.285, 0.463, 55.02
CIE-LCH 79.053, 64.564, 148.416
CIE-LUV 79.053, -56.335, 54.887
Hunter-Lab 74.175, -48.144, 27.983
Binary 01011011, 11011100, 10000010

Shades and Tints of #5bdc82

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e06 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.
